Kayne Anderson Rudnick Investment Management LLC reduced its position in shares of I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. (NASDAQ:IDXX - Free Report) by 8.2%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 119,187 shares of the company's stock after selling 10,715 shares during the quarter. Kayne Anderson Rudnick Investment Management LLC owned about 0.15% of IDEXX Laboratories worth $50,053,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Activity at IDEXX Laboratories

In other news, EVP Nimrata Hunt sold 7,143 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, August 6th. The stock was sold at an average price of $630.43, for a total transaction of $4,503,161.49. Following the sale, the executive vice president directly owned 18,007 shares in the company, valued at approximately $11,352,153.01. The trade was a 28.40%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website. Also, CEO Jonathan Jay Mazelsky sold 29,260 shares of IDEXX Laboratories st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, August 6th. The shares were sold at an average price of $631.98, for a total value of $18,491,734.80. Following the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 83,311 shares in the company, valued at $52,650,885.78. The trade was a 25.99% decrease in their ownership of the stock. IDEXX Laboratories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:IDXX opened at $645.55 on Monday. The company has a current ratio of 1.11, a quick ratio of 0.79 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.31. I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. has a 1 year low of $356.14 and a 1 year high of $688.12.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$569.94 and a 200 day simple moving average of $494.38. The firm has a market cap of $51.64 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 53.75, a P/E/G ratio of 4.18 and a beta of 1.49.

IDEXX Laboratories (NASDAQ:IDXX -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Monday, August 4th. The company reported $3.63 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$3.28 by $0.35. IDEXX Laboratories had a return on equity of 64.42% and a net margin of 24.41%.The business had revenue of $1.11 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.06 billion. During the same period last year, the company earned $2.44 earnings per share. IDEXX Laboratories's quarterly revenue was up 10.6% compared to the same quarter last year. IDEXX Laboratories has set its FY 2025 guidance at 12.400-12.760 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. will post 11.93 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About IDEXX Laboratories

(Free Report)

IDEXX Laboratories, Inc develops, manufactures, and distributes products primarily for the companion animal veterinary, livestock and poultry, dairy, and water testing markets in Africa, the Asia Pacific, Canada, Europe, Latin America, and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Companion Animal Group; Water Quality Products; and Livestock, Poultry and Dairy.
